Harvest Assembly

This morning we had our annual harvest assembly.  We were joined by our special guest, Mr Povey, who told us a story about the true meaning of harvest time.

P5 were excellent, telling the whole school and our parents/carers all about when and why we celebrate at this time.  Club Wild also presented and shared their learning with us and had lots of fresh vegetables to sell.

A huge thank you to all of our pupils, parents and carers for donating so generously to our West Lothian Food Bank collection.  We hope to continue supporting this very worthy charity throughout the year.

Harvesting at Nursery

We have been harvesting our vegetables from the nursery garden over the last 2 weeks. We have used our carrots, tomatoes,  squash and onions to make healthy pizzas and we ate them for snack.  Some of us made our own pizzas at the craft table and we put them on the wall. They look just like real pizzas!!

We have shown an interest in minibeasts and in the garden we found some worms,  snails, earwigs,  woodlouse and a spider. We have drawn lots of pictures of the minibeasts for our display.

We also had a visit from our parents when we showed them all the things we enjoy doing in the nursery at our first Pop In And Play session.

 

Learning about Harvest

Primary 1 have been learning about autumn time and harvest.  Today we were talking and learning about Harvest in particular.  We watched a power point and discussed how vegetables and fruit are harvested – from under the ground, above the ground and from trees/plants. Afterwards we unwrapped a range of vegetables and had the opportunity to use our senses to investigate.  Tomorrow we will be able to look even closer at our vegetables using magnifying glasses and peeling the layers off  to explore inside.
